首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>使用Kustomize部署现有作业

使用Kustomize部署现有作业
EN

Stack Overflow用户
提问于 2019-01-25 09:33:51
回答 1查看 1.2K关注 0票数 1

我们目前正在使用Kustomize来管理Kubernetes的部署,Jenkins作为ci/cd。当Kustomize构建清单,然后kubectl获取输出并应用它们时,当有一个作业并且作业已经存在时,api_server抛出一个错误,因此部署失败。我希望避免创建一个复杂的Jenkinsfile,该文件解析yaml文件以查找作业类规范,然后采取进一步的操作,这将使Jenkinsfile逻辑过于复杂。是否有人在使用同样的工具,也面临着同样的问题?在不让Jenkins知道清单类型的情况下,哪种方法可以实现管道中的作业部署?

EN

回答 1

Stack Overflow用户

发布于 2019-04-01 23:57:34

库: Jenkins管道中的共享库

您可能希望使用https://jenkins.io/doc/book/pipeline/shared-libraries/共享库并开放源代码您的规范。

这将极大地帮助公众

备选方案

或者,你也可以考虑

  1. https://jenkins-x.io/
  2. https://draft.sh/
票数 -3
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/54362427

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档